Product details

Overview

MLX90411KZE-BAA-023-RE from Melexis is a single-coil, code-free brushless DC fan driver IC for 5V/12V/24V cooling systems, delivering up to 1 A output current and 15 W power with adaptive low-noise commutation, PWM speed control (±1.5% accuracy), and integrated diagnostics. It targets graphic card cooling fans, refrigerator fans, and mobile air-conditioner water-spreading pumps.

For engineers reviewing the MLX90411KZE-BAA-023-RE datasheet, pinout, applications, or equivalent options, key selection factors include its 3.2–32 V operating supply range, -40 to +125 °C junction temperature rating, UTDFN-8 (2.5 × 2.0 × 0.4 mm) package, open-drain FG/RD diagnostics, and UL/VDE/CE-ready compliance for consumer-grade thermal management.

Technical Context

The MLX90411KZE-BAA-023-RE integrates a Hall-effect sensor, gate driver, and power MOSFETs in a single UTDFN-8 package, enabling direct single-coil BLDC motor control without external microcontroller or firmware. Its adaptive commutation algorithm dynamically adjusts timing to minimize acoustic noise and mechanical vibration.

It supports three speed control modes via PWM input: standby, open-loop, and closed-loop (with ±1.5% speed regulation). Built-in protections include locked rotor detection, overtemperature shutdown, overvoltage clamp, short-circuit current limiting, and open-load diagnostics on FG and RD pins.

Pinout & Package

MLX90411KZE-BAA-023-RE is housed in a 8-pin UTDFN package (2.5 × 2.0 × 0.4 mm) with wettable flanks and an exposed thermal pad (EP) for enhanced thermal performance. Pin numbering follows standard UTDFN top-view convention, with Pin 1 marked by a dot.

Pin/TerminalCircuit RoleDesign Meaning
VDDPower supply inputAccepts 3.2–32 V DC; internal LDO powers logic and sensor circuitry
GNDGround referenceCommon return path for power, logic, and thermal pad (EP must be soldered to GND plane)
OUTPHigh-side driver outputConnects to motor coil terminal; integrates N-channel MOSFET with 1 A continuous rating
OUTNLow-side driver outputConnects to opposite motor coil terminal; complements OUTP for single-coil H-bridge operation
PWMSpeed control inputActive-high TTL/CMOS-compatible signal; configures standby, open-loop, or closed-loop mode
FGFan tachometer outputOpen-drain pulse output (2 pulses per revolution); requires external pull-up for MCU interface
RDRotor lock/fault indicatorOpen-drain active-low alarm; asserts during stall, overtemp, or overcurrent events
EPExposed thermal padMust be soldered to PCB GND plane for thermal conduction and EMI reduction

Melexis is a Belgian semiconductor company specializing in intelligent sensor and driver ICs for automotive, industrial, and consumer markets, with core expertise in magnetic sensing and motor control.

The MLX90411 family delivers integrated, code-free BLDC fan drivers targeting high-efficiency, low-noise thermal management in space-constrained consumer appliances and computing peripherals.

FAQ

What is the maximum continuous output current of the MLX90411KZE-BAA-023-RE?

The MLX90411KZE-BAA-023-RE supports a maximum continuous output current of 1 A under specified thermal conditions (PCB copper area ≥ 100 mm², ambient ≤ 85 °C). This enables reliable 15 W drive capability for single-coil BLDC fans. Derating applies above 85 °C ambient or with insufficient copper pour. The MLX90411KZE-BAA-023-RE integrates current-limit protection to prevent damage during overload.

Does the MLX90411KZE-BAA-023-RE require external programming or firmware?

No, the MLX90411KZE-BAA-023-RE operates code-free - no external microcontroller, EEPROM, or programming tool is needed. It enters operational mode immediately after power-up using factory-configured parameters. Configuration is fixed at manufacture; variants like the MLX90411-D support I²C programming, but the MLX90411KZE-BAA-023-RE uses hardwired settings for plug-and-play deployment.

What protection features are built into the MLX90411KZE-BAA-023-RE?

The MLX90411KZE-BAA-023-RE includes locked rotor detection, overtemperature shutdown (at +150 °C junction), overvoltage clamping (up to 40 V), short-circuit current limiting, and open-load diagnostics on both FG and RD pins. These protections activate autonomously without external components. Each fault condition triggers the RD pin to assert low, allowing host systems to log or respond to failures - a core safety feature of the MLX90411KZE-BAA-023-RE.

Can the MLX90411KZE-BAA-023-RE drive motors other than cooling fans?

Yes - the MLX90411KZE-BAA-023-RE is designed for single-coil BLDC motors with rated power ≤ 15 W and supply voltage 3.2–32 V, including epilator actuators, small water pumps, and precision air movers. Its adaptive commutation and low-noise profile make it suitable for any application prioritizing acoustic performance and compact integration. However, it is not intended for multi-phase or high-inertia loads outside its validated use cases.
